INTERNAL MEMO — Regional Sales Review

Northvale region closed Q2 at 94% of target; Estmere exceeded plan by 11%. Dorrington underperformed for a third consecutive quarter; Fenn Larkwood will present a recovery plan next month. Headcount freeze remains in place. The board should read this alongside the confidential planning note appended directly below.

board note of bawep-tajef: Queniusek Systems plans to raise the Quenvan list price by 53.1 percent in March. The pricing group signed off on a budget of $176.4 million for Project Drueth. The renewal with Casionix Partners closes at $142.5 million a year, 8.3 percent below the last contract. Project Fraax slips by six weeks because of the tooling delay.

## Changelog — Font vendoring defaults changed

As of this release, the Bracken UI build no longer fetches third-party fonts at build time. All typefaces used by the Lanternwell suite are now vendored into the repo under a dedicated assets directory, and the fetch step is skipped by default. If you're onboarding, nothing to install — the fonts travel with the checkout. The build flags controlling this behavior are listed below.

settings of hadup-yafog:
LAMAEL_PIN=3761
LAMAEL_TENANT=istmir
LAMAEL_METRICS_HOST=metrics.lamael.plorvasys.test
LAMAEL_SEAL=seal_8ea68500
LAMAEL_STANDBY_TEAM=fraok

Night shift: evacuation-chair store on Stairwell C, Level 3, was restocked today. Two Havermont chairs serviced, one sent to Drayle Safety for repair. Check the seal on the store door at 02:00 rounds. If the seal is broken, log it and re-secure. Door access for the store uses the pass below.

staff pass of fajop-kajop = bdg-H-83